Finishing up the mods for this season and I come to what I think will be the easiest one and realize, "hey I need a third hand??"
I picked up some visors for the headlight and lightbar. Unbolted the ring and take out the clips and light. Insert the visor and try to fit the light back in while holding everything in place to try and put the clips back on. This in going on the second day of not being able to do this and I've finally given in to asking for help on my inability to figure this simple add on.

As stated above, they are not a perfect fit by any means. Swearing does help though. I used some side cutters and just cut the tabs off and they fit a lot easier. The biggest visor is the hardest for sure and requires bending it until just before it tweaks and is ruined. This one also fits the worst, it's bigger than the light.
